PTLO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

196 of the 7,459 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Portillo's (PTLO)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$742M — up 39% from $535M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new PTLO positions and 38 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 64 added to existing stakes and 46 trimmed.

The largest buyer was AllianceBernstein, adding an estimated $63.8M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$20.9M.
